GBTC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2025 in Review

762 of the 7,596 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Grayscale Bitcoin Trust (GBTC) for Q2 2025, worth a combined $2.98B — up 33% from $2.24B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 109 funds opened new GBTC positions and 48 closed out — a net gain of 61 holders — while 140 added to existing stakes and 256 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Jane Street, adding an estimated $54.4M. The largest seller was DRW Securities, cutting an estimated $26.9M.
